Output f8592958ddf4125330ee51e0ddb42be1fecf2b842f91507c2dfb8b65ad588cd9:3

value
506897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40b4eeac9c05c39d5422c368954ca766a9a14eac OP_EQUAL
address
37b9vDetf797peKynLU6d56ANb1db7ea6U
transaction
f8592958ddf4125330ee51e0ddb42be1fecf2b842f91507c2dfb8b65ad588cd9
spent
true